AMN Healthcare in Dallas is seeking a Corporate Counsel to partner with Sales and Operations to draft, review, and negotiate contracts that reflect the business relationship while mitigating risk. This role provides legal advice on operations and compliance.
You will engage stakeholders, tailor contract templates, ensure policy compliance, and conduct training for internal teams on contracts. A J.D., Texas bar admission, and 7–10 years of relevant experience are required.
